Fenugreek: Colon Health Benefits

Sheeh or fenugreek, scientifically known as Trigonella foenum-graecum, is a plant renowned for its culinary and medicinal applications, including its potential benefits for colon health. The seeds of fenugreek are commonly used in cooking, traditional medicine, and various health supplements due to their rich nutritional profile and potential therapeutic properties. When it comes to colon health, fenugreek offers several potential benefits, supported by both traditional knowledge and emerging scientific research.

One of the primary ways fenugreek may benefit the colon is through its high fiber content. Fiber plays a crucial role in digestive health, particularly in maintaining regular bowel movements and preventing constipation. Fenugreek seeds are rich in soluble fiber, which absorbs water in the digestive tract, forming a gel-like substance that helps soften stool and promote regularity. By supporting healthy bowel movements, fenugreek can contribute to overall colon health and reduce the risk of conditions such as constipation and hemorrhoids.

Furthermore, fenugreek contains compounds with anti-inflammatory properties, such as flavonoids and saponins. Inflammation is a key factor in the development of various digestive disorders, including inflammatory bowel diseases (IBD) like Crohn’s disease and ulcerative colitis. Research suggests that fenugreek may help reduce inflammation in the colon and alleviate symptoms associated with these conditions. By modulating inflammatory pathways, fenugreek may support the overall health of the colon and reduce the risk of chronic inflammation-related complications.

Moreover, fenugreek seeds are rich in antioxidants, including polyphenols and flavonoids, which help protect cells from oxidative damage caused by free radicals. Oxidative stress is implicated in the pathogenesis of various gastrointestinal disorders, including colon cancer. By scavenging free radicals and inhibiting oxidative damage, fenugreek may help protect the colon against cellular injury and reduce the risk of colon cancer development. While more research is needed to fully elucidate the specific mechanisms underlying fenugreek’s protective effects against colon cancer, its antioxidant properties hold promise in this regard.

Additionally, fenugreek seeds contain mucilage, a gelatinous substance that forms a protective coating along the lining of the colon. This mucilaginous property of fenugreek may help soothe inflammation, reduce irritation, and promote the healing of damaged tissues in the colon. Moreover, the mucilage acts as a lubricant, facilitating the passage of stool through the digestive tract and reducing the risk of injury or irritation to the colon mucosa. By providing a protective barrier and promoting gastrointestinal motility, fenugreek mucilage may contribute to overall colon health and function.

Furthermore, fenugreek seeds have been traditionally used to alleviate gastrointestinal symptoms such as indigestion, bloating, and gas. These seeds contain compounds that stimulate digestive enzymes, enhance nutrient absorption, and regulate gastrointestinal motility, thereby promoting optimal digestive function and reducing discomfort associated with digestive disturbances. By improving digestive health, fenugreek may indirectly support colon health and reduce the risk of gastrointestinal disorders.

Moreover, fenugreek seeds have been investigated for their potential role in regulating blood sugar levels, which is important for individuals with diabetes, a condition associated with an increased risk of colon cancer and other gastrointestinal complications. Fenugreek contains soluble fiber, which slows down the absorption of glucose in the intestines and helps regulate blood sugar levels. Additionally, fenugreek seeds contain compounds such as trigonelline and galactomannan, which may enhance insulin sensitivity and promote glucose uptake by cells. By improving glycemic control, fenugreek may reduce the risk of diabetes-related complications, including those affecting the colon.

Furthermore, fenugreek seeds have been studied for their potential cholesterol-lowering effects, which could indirectly benefit colon health. High levels of cholesterol in the blood are associated with an increased risk of cardiovascular disease, which may also impact colon health. Fenugreek contains soluble fiber and compounds such as saponins, which help reduce cholesterol absorption in the intestines and promote its excretion from the body. By lowering cholesterol levels, fenugreek may help prevent the development of atherosclerosis and other cardiovascular conditions that could adversely affect colon health.

Moreover, fenugreek seeds have been explored for their antimicrobial properties, which may help maintain a healthy balance of gut microbiota. Imbalances in the gut microbiome have been implicated in various gastrointestinal disorders, including inflammatory bowel diseases and colorectal cancer. Fenugreek contains compounds such as diosgenin and fenugreekine, which exhibit antibacterial and antifungal activities against pathogens that can disrupt gut microbiota balance. By inhibiting the growth of harmful microorganisms and promoting the growth of beneficial bacteria, fenugreek may support a healthy gut environment conducive to optimal colon health.

Furthermore, fenugreek seeds have been investigated for their potential anti-cancer properties, which could have implications for colon cancer prevention and treatment. Studies have shown that fenugreek extracts exhibit cytotoxic effects against cancer cells, including colon cancer cells, by inducing apoptosis (programmed cell death) and inhibiting tumor growth. Moreover, fenugreek contains bioactive compounds such as diosgenin, which have been shown to inhibit the proliferation of colon cancer cells and suppress tumor progression. By targeting cancer cells and modulating signaling pathways involved in carcinogenesis, fenugreek may hold promise as a complementary therapy for colon cancer management.

In conclusion, fenugreek offers numerous potential benefits for colon health, supported by its rich nutritional profile and diverse bioactive compounds. From its high fiber content and anti-inflammatory properties to its antioxidant, mucilaginous, and antimicrobial effects, fenugreek contributes to digestive health and may help prevent or alleviate various gastrointestinal disorders, including constipation, inflammation, and colon cancer. While further research is warranted to fully elucidate the mechanisms underlying fenugreek’s effects on colon health and to validate its therapeutic potential in clinical settings, incorporating fenugreek into a balanced diet and lifestyle may offer holistic support for maintaining optimal colon function and reducing the risk of colon-related complications.

Fenugreek, scientifically known as Trigonella foenum-graecum, is an annual herb native to the Mediterranean region, southern Europe, and western Asia. It belongs to the Fabaceae family, commonly referred to as the legume, pea, or bean family. Fenugreek has a long history of use in various cultures, both culinary and medicinal, dating back thousands of years. The plant bears small, golden-brown seeds that have a distinct aroma and a slightly bitter taste, which intensifies when the seeds are roasted or ground.

In addition to its culinary uses as a spice and flavoring agent in various cuisines, fenugreek has been employed in traditional medicine systems, including Ayurveda, traditional Chinese medicine (TCM), and traditional Arabic medicine, for its numerous health benefits. It is revered for its medicinal properties and has been used to address a wide range of health issues, including digestive disorders, respiratory ailments, reproductive health concerns, and metabolic imbalances.
